SAHCO Records N11 Billion Revenue in 2022, Plans for Continued Growth

Skyway Aviation Handling Company (SAHCO) has reported a substantial increase in revenue, with a growth of 28% from N8.6 billion in the previous year to N11.1 billion in 2022.

According to SAHCO’s audited financial results for 2022, pre-tax profit rose by 14.69% to N4.37 billion, compared to N3.81 billion recorded in 2021.

The SAHCO board has approved a dividend of 16.50k per ordinary share of 50k to its shareholders, amounting to N223 million, the same dividend paid in the previous financial year.

During the period under review, SAHCO’s total assets improved by 18.74% to N29.22 billion, demonstrating significant growth compared to N24.61 billion in 2021.

Speaking at the 13th Annual General Meeting held in Lagos, the Chairman of SAHCO, Dr. Taiwo Afolabi, highlighted the company’s substantial investments made in the year to enhance its capacity to serve clients. These investments included the acquisition of modern equipment, provision of new facilities, and capacity development for staff and board members.

Dr. Afolabi also shared that the company’s financial report for Q1 2023 indicated a positive growth trajectory, expressing confidence in achieving even greater success in the next financial year.

He stated, “Our first quarter financial year result has shown that we are making more money. So, we will surprise them by next year and maybe double whatever we are giving them this year. We are confident that this is going to happen in the next financial year.”
